Understanding the Geography of Outer West Durban
Outer West Durban encompasses various suburbs, including Westville, Kloof, and Hillcrest, each presenting unique logistical considerations. The region's geography features a mix of residential estates, commercial zones, and natural landscapes, which can influence transport routes.
Many areas, such as Kloof and Hillcrest, have gated communities and security estates, which may have restricted access times or specific entry points. Understanding these restrictions is crucial for timely deliveries.
- Consider peak traffic times, especially during school runs and rush hours.
- Familiarize yourself with alternative routes to avoid congestion on main roads like the N3.
- Utilize local knowledge to identify shortcuts and lesser-known paths.

Frequently Asked Questions
Peak traffic times in Outer West Durban typically occur during weekday mornings from 7 AM to 9 AM and afternoons from 4 PM to 6 PM. It's advisable to plan deliveries outside these hours to minimize delays.
Yes, many residential estates in Outer West Durban have specific access control measures, including restricted entry times and security protocols. Familiarizing yourself with these requirements is essential for smooth deliveries.
You can stay updated on local road conditions by following community news outlets, social media groups focused on KZN transport, and using navigation apps that provide real-time traffic updates.
The choice of vehicle depends on the size and nature of the delivery. For smaller loads, a bakkie may suffice, while larger deliveries may require a truck. It’s important to assess the load and route to determine the best vehicle.
